Libro Python Aplicado de Eugenia Bahit. GNU/Linux, ciencia de datos, y desarrollo web

Banner de Python Aplicado

Elementos del Lenguaje


Cita con formato IEEE:
E. Bahit, "Elementos del lenguaje", in Python Aplicado, 4th ed., EBRC Publisher, 2022, pp. 24–28.

Cita con formato APA 7:
Bahit, E. (2022). Elementos del lenguaje. In Python Aplicado (4th ed., pp. 24–28). EBRC Publisher.

Cita en línea:
(Bahit, 2022)

Python, como todo lenguaje de programación, se compone de una serie de elementos característicos y estructuras. A continuación, se abarcarán los principales elementos.

Variables

Una variable es un espacio para almacenar datos modificables de forma temporal en la memoria del ordenador. En Python, una variable se define con la sintaxis:

nombre_de_la_variable = valor_de_la_variable

Cada variable, tiene un nombre y un valor. Este último, define el tipo de datos de la variable.

Existe un tipo de espacio de almacenamiento denominado constante. Una constante, se utiliza para definir valores fijos, que no requieran ser modificados. En Python, el concepto de constante es simbólico ya que todo espacio es variable.

PEP 8: variables
Utilizar nombres descriptivos y en minúsculas. Para nombres compuestos, separar las palabras por guiones bajos. Antes y después del signo =, debe haber uno (y solo un) espacio en blanco.

Forma correcta:
mi_variable

Formas incorrectas:
MiVariable, mivariable, VARIABLE

Asignación correcta:
variable = 12

Asignaciones incorrectas:
variable=12 variable =   12 variable   = 12

PEP 8: constantes
Utilizar nombres descriptivos y en mayúsculas separando palabras por guiones bajos.
Ejemplo: MI_CONSTANTE = 12

Entrada y salida

Para imprimir un valor en pantalla hasta la versión 2.7 de Python, se utiliza la palabra clave :

mi_variable = 15
print mi_variable

Pero a partir de la versión 3.0 de Python, se utiliza la función print():

mi_variable = 15
print(mi_variable)
Es importante destacar que la función print() también estaba disponible en Python 2.

Lo anterior, en ambos casos, imprime el valor de la variable mi_variable en pantalla.

Para obtener datos solicitados al usuario hasta la versión 2.7 de Python, se utiliza la función raw_input():

mi_variable = raw_input("Ingresar un valor: ")

A partir de la versión 3.0 de Python, se utiliza la función...

para continuar leyendo este capítulo puedes adquirir el PDF o el libro en papel